How to Build a Healthcare App Like Practo: A Step-by-Step Guide
Developing a Healthcare App Like Practo: A Comprehensive Guide
The healthcare industry has witnessed a massive shift towards digital transformation in recent years. One of the key players in this transformation is healthcare apps like Practo, which have revolutionized the way people access medical services. From booking doctor appointments to finding nearby healthcare providers and managing medical records, these apps offer a range of services to streamline the healthcare experience for users. If you are considering developing a healthcare app like Practo, this guide will take you through the key steps and considerations for creating a successful platform.
1. Understand the Market and User Needs
Before diving into the technical aspects of developing a healthcare app, it’s important to understand the market and what users expect from such an app. Healthcare apps like Practo are designed to bridge the gap between patients and healthcare providers. Users seek convenience, security, and a seamless experience. As part of the market research, you need to identify the specific needs of your target audience. This could include features such as easy appointment booking, access to medical records, consultation with doctors via telemedicine, and more.
2. Define the Core Features
The next step in developing a healthcare app like Practo is determining the core features of the app. A successful healthcare app must offer a user-friendly interface with practical and essential features. Here are some core features that you may want to consider integrating into your healthcare app:
a. Doctor Search and Appointment Booking
One of the primary reasons users turn to apps like Practo is to find and book appointments with doctors. Ensure your app has a feature where users can search for doctors based on specialty, location, and availability. Include filters for ratings, consultation fees, and availability.
b. Telemedicine Integration
In today’s digital age, telemedicine has become increasingly popular, allowing patients to consult doctors remotely. Integrating telemedicine capabilities into your app will make healthcare more accessible, especially for those who cannot visit a clinic in person.
c. Electronic Health Records (EHR)
Users expect to access their medical history in a secure and digital format. Developing a healthcare app like Practo means offering features like electronic health records (EHR) where users can store and manage their medical information, including prescriptions, test results, and doctor’s notes.
d. In-App Payments and Insurance Integration
Streamlining payment options is crucial for any healthcare app. Users should be able to pay for their consultations or treatments directly through the app. Integration with insurance providers can also be a valuable feature to help users verify insurance coverage and make hassle-free payments.
e. Reviews and Ratings
Allowing users to rate and review doctors, clinics, and services is an important feature for building trust and credibility. By offering a transparent feedback system, you enable users to make informed decisions about the healthcare professionals they choose.
f. Notifications and Reminders
Push notifications and reminders play a vital role in patient engagement. These can include reminders for upcoming appointments, medication schedules, or follow-up consultations.
3. Choose the Right Technology Stack
Choosing the right technology stack is crucial for the development of your healthcare app. Consider the following technologies when bulid an app like Practo:
Frontend Development: Use frameworks like React Native or Flutter to ensure that your app is responsive and works smoothly across both Android and iOS platforms.
Backend Development: A scalable backend using technologies like Node.js, Python, or Ruby on Rails will ensure your app can handle a large volume of users and medical data securely.
Database: Opt for secure databases like MongoDB or PostgreSQL for storing user and healthcare provider data. Security is a top priority in healthcare, so choose databases with robust encryption features.
Cloud Integration: Cloud platforms like AWS or Google Cloud can provide reliable storage and computational resources, which are essential for handling large amounts of medical data.
4. Focus on Data Security and Compliance
Since healthcare apps deal with sensitive user information, ensuring data security is crucial. To build trust with your users, make sure that your app complies with industry standards and regulations, such as the Health Insurance Portability and Accountability Act (HIPAA) in the U.S. or GDPR in Europe. Implement end-to-end encryption for data storage and communication, two-factor authentication for user logins, and regular security audits.
5. Design a User-Friendly Interface
User experience (UX) is vital for the success of any app, and healthcare apps are no exception. When developing a healthcare app services, it’s essential to design an intuitive, easy-to-navigate interface. Healthcare can be a stressful topic for many people, so the last thing you want is for the app to add to their frustration. Focus on simplicity, clear instructions, and fast-loading pages.
6. Test and Launch the App
Once the app has been developed, it’s crucial to perform rigorous testing to ensure that it works as expected. This includes functional testing, user acceptance testing, and security testing. After testing, launch your app on both Android and iOS platforms. Promote it through various channels to ensure that users know about your app.
7. Post-Launch Support and Updates
Developing a healthcare app development doesn’t stop at launch. Continuous support and regular updates are essential to keep the app running smoothly and enhance its functionality. Gather feedback from users to identify areas for improvement and release updates accordingly. You should also monitor the app’s performance and fix any bugs promptly.
Conclusion
Developing a healthcare app like Practo can be a highly rewarding venture. By offering a convenient, secure, and user-friendly platform, you can help bridge the gap between healthcare providers and patients. By focusing on essential features, robust security, and ongoing support, you can create an app that provides real value to users and improves the healthcare experience overall.
%20(1).jpg)
Comments
Post a Comment